Centaurea americana is indeed a treasure among America's wildflowers. The common name for it, basket-flower, comes from the intricate structure at the base of the flower head. In this photograph the golden color of the lower part of the background (and the background is completely natural, I'll add, as in all my photographs) mimics the gold of the floral basket.
